Study On T Lymphocyte Recognition Of Tumor Antigens On Autologous CML Cells

Relapse is the major concern in patients with leukemia after successful treatment with chemotherapy or bone marrow transplantation. Eradication in vitro of minimal residual blasts or in vitro purging of bone marrow grafts to minimize leukemia cells reinfused is being widely studied. Recently, immunotherapy for the minimal residual blast populations by activation of autologous cytotoxic cells with inter-leukin-2 (LAK cells) emerges as a new promising modality.However,in most cases LAK cells possess no or limited cytolytic activity against autologous CML tumor cells and can not be used in CML patients for bone marrow purging. The present study was designed to investigate whether there are cytotoxic precursor cells in previously untreated or remissive CML patients to identify their phenotypical and function characteristics, and to analyse the relationship between the tumor antigens recognized by T lymphocytes and the peptides corresponding to the BCR- ABL joining region.For this purpose,MNC were isolated from bone marrow or peripheral, blood of previously untreated or remissive CML patients and cultured for 4-8 weeks in the presence of recombinant IL-2 (100U/ml)and IL-1(100U/ml) after initial anti-CD3 mAbs stimulation.The resulting T-cell populations were characterized of their phenotypical and function features. The overall results were as follows:1.A kind of cytotoxic T lymphocytes can be generated from bone marrow or peripheral blood of previously untreated or remissive CML patients. These T cells showed variABLe cytotoxicity against autologous and allogeneic CML cells and no activity to autologous and allogeneic normal bone marrow cells.They also exhibited relatively intensive cytotoxicities against LAk sensitive Raji cells and NK sensitive K562 cells.
